// Delphi interface unit for the windowless rich-edit control
// http://msdn.microsoft.com/library/en-us/shellcc/platform/commctls/richedit/windowlessricheditcontrols.asp
// Copyright © 2003-2006 Rob Kennedy. Some rights reserved.
// For license information, see http://www.cs.wisc.edu/~rkennedy/license
// This code was written using Delphi 5. It should not require any special
// features missing from previous versions, though, except for the obvious
// COM interface support. It should also work with later Delphi versions.
unit TOM;
interface
uses Windows, ActiveX, RichEdit, IMM;

// TTextHostImpl is a helper class for implementors of the ITextHost
// interface in Delphi. It could have been declared as an actual
// implementor of ITextHost itself, but since it has to be wrapped by
// CreateTextHost anyway, I didn't want to have to deal with reference
// counting of a helper class and forwarding calls to IUnknown's methods.
// TTextHostImpl provides default implementations for most of the
// methods. Override them in descendents. TxGetPropertyBits is an
// abstract method since I could not decide on a suitable default return
// value. The layout of this class is important. The virtual-method table
// MUST have the same layout as the ITextHost method table. To use
// TTextHostImpl with a windowless rich-edit control, create an instance
// of a descendent and pass it to CreateTextHost (declared below).
// CreateTextHost takes ownership of the TTextHostImpl object; do not
// free it.
TTextHostImpl = class

// CreateTextHost wraps a TTextHostImpl instance and returns an ITextHost
// interface reference suitable for passing to CreateTextServices.
//
// Caution: Delphi code must NEVER call any functions using the returned
// interface, except for the methods introduced in IUnknown. The actual
// ITextHost methods use the thiscall calling convention, which Delphi
// doesn't understand. If you need to call those methods, call them via
// the original TTextHostImpl reference instead.
//
// See also: TTextHostImpl
function CreateTextHost(const Impl: TTextHostImpl): ITextHost;
// This is the API function, documented by Microsoft. See MSDN for details.
function CreateTextServices(punkOuter: IUnknown; pITextHost: ITextHost; out ppUnk): HResult; stdcall;
// PatchTextServices takes an ITextServices reference, as returned by
// CreateTextServices, and wraps it within a Delphi-compatible
// ITextServices implementation.
//
// Services
// [in,out] On entry, this parameter is a reference to an ITextServices
// object returned by CreateTextServices. On exit, it is a reference to a
// new ITextServices object suitable for use in Delphi.
//
// This function is necessary because the ITextServices interface is
// written to expect the thiscall calling convention, not the usual
// stdcall. Instead of passing Self as a regular variable on the stack, it
// is passed in the ECX register. PatchTextServices creates a wrapper
// object that fixes the stack layout for each function before forwarding
// the call to the original object.
//
// See also: CreateTextServices
procedure PatchTextServices(var Services: ITextServices);

// Many of the following routines are declared without any parameters or
// return types. This is because they must use the stdcall calling
// convention, but the compiler automatically adds prologue and epilogue
// code for all stdcall functions, even if it isn't strictly necessary.
// This is OK, though, since these functions are all implemented in
// assembler and they are never called by any Delphi code. They're always
// called via an interface reference, usually by the operating system.

// These stubs get called as stdcall methods. They translate the stack into
// a thiscall method. First, there is a breakpoint, which can be set or
// ignored when a method is patched. Next, we pop the return address into
// EDX. Then we pop the Self parameter that Delphi puts at the top of the
// stack. It's actually a PITextServices value. The real ITextServices
// implementor is expecting to find its instance reference in ECX when we
// call it, and that got stored in the Inst field of the TITextServices
// record by the PatchTextServices function. After we set ECX, we push the
// return address back onto the stack (note the PITextServices reference is
// *not* pushed back on). ECX points to the first entry of the
// implementor's VMT, so we add an offset to that pointer and jump to the
// address stored there.
procedure TextServices_TxSendMessage; // (msg: UInt; wParam: wParam; lParam: lParam; out plresult: lResult): HResult; stdcall;
asm
pop edx // return address
pop eax
mov ecx, [eax].TITextServices.Impl
push edx // return address
mov eax, [ecx]
jmp dword ptr [eax].TITextServicesMT.TxSendMessage
end;

// When these stubs get called, it is as thiscall methods. We translate it
// to a stdcall method and then jump to the Delphi object method that's
// implementing the interface. ECX refers to the PITextHost value that
// CreateTextHost returned as an ITextHost reference. Besides a pointer to
// a VMT of these method stubs, that record also contains a reference to
// the TTextHostImpl instance, eight bytes into the record. That reference
// gets stored in EAX and then pushed onto the stack underneath the return
// address. Then we fetch the address of the method being wrapped from the
// TTextHostImpl's VMT and jump to that method.
procedure TextHost_TxGetDC; // : HDC; stdcall;
asm
pop edx // return address
mov eax, [ecx].TITextHost.Impl
push eax
push edx // return address
mov eax, [eax]
jmp dword ptr [eax + vmtoffset TTextHostImpl.TxGetDC]
end;
